BLUE BIRD - HN1280 - ROYAL
BLUE BIRD - HN1280 - ROYAL DOULTON FIGURINEHandpainted child study of a girl holding a blue bird. Part of the Harridine Child Classics series. In the play, "The Blue Bird", by Maurice Maeterlinck, the two children of a poor woodcutter are sent in search of a Blue Bird of Happiness by the fairy Berylune only to find it in their own house. Royal Doulton backstamp. Hand written title and HN number.
Artist: Leslie Harradine
Issued: 1928 - 1938
Dimensions: 4.75"H
Manufacturer: Royal Doulton
Country of Origin: England
